Choosing the Right Wood for Your Wooden Spoons: A Buyer’s Guide

Making wooden spoons is a rewarding craft. The wood you choose makes a big difference. It affects how easy the spoon is to carve. It also changes how long the spoon lasts. This guide helps you pick the best wood for your project.

Key Features to Look For in Spoon Wood

Good spoon wood has several important features. You want wood that carves smoothly. It should also be safe for food. Look for these key points:

  • Grain Structure: Look for wood with a tight, closed grain. Open-grained wood, like oak, can trap food particles. Tight grain makes cleaning easier.
  • Hardness (Density): The wood needs to be hard enough to last. Softwoods break easily. Very hard woods are tough to carve. Medium-hard woods are often best.
  • Toxicity and Safety: Since spoons go in your mouth, the wood must be food-safe. Avoid woods treated with chemicals or those known to cause allergies.
  • Appearance: Color and figure (the pattern in the wood) matter for looks. Light woods show stains less than very dark woods.
Important Materials: The Best Woods for Spoons

Many types of wood work well for spoons. Different woods offer different benefits. Here are the most popular and recommended materials:

Hardwoods are Usually Best

Hardwoods come from broad-leafed trees. They generally make durable spoons.

  • Maple (Sugar or Hard Maple): This is a top choice. Maple is very hard and smooth. It resists odors and stains well. It carves nicely when green (freshly cut).
  • Cherry: Cherry wood is beautiful. It has a warm, reddish color. It is medium-hard and carves smoothly. Its color darkens nicely with age and use.
  • Walnut: Walnut offers a deep, rich brown color. It is a favorite for its looks. It is slightly softer than maple but still very durable.
  • Birch: Birch is an affordable and common choice. It is light in color and carves relatively easily. It is a good option for beginners.
Woods to Use with Caution

Some woods are fine, but they have drawbacks.

  • Beech: It is hard and takes a good finish. However, it can absorb odors if not oiled properly.
  • Ash: Ash is strong. It can sometimes splinter during carving if you are not careful.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

The quality of your final spoon depends heavily on the wood’s condition and how you handle it.

Factors That Improve Quality:

Always choose wood that is properly dried or “green.” Green wood is easier to shape because it has more moisture. If you use kiln-dried wood, it must be very uniform. Look for wood free of knots or cracks. Knots create weak spots. They make carving much harder.

Factors That Reduce Quality:

Avoid wood that shows signs of rot or insect damage. These areas weaken the spoon structure. Wood that is too dry can crack unexpectedly during carving. Wood with very coarse, open grain will soak up liquids and grease, making the spoon harder to keep clean. Poorly seasoned wood warps as it dries, ruining the shape.

User Experience and Use Cases

How you plan to use the spoon affects your wood choice. Different woods feel different in your hand.

For Cooking and Stirring:

If the spoon will spend a lot of time in hot pots, choose dense woods like maple or cherry. These woods handle heat better. They resist staining from tomato sauces or turmeric.

For Serving and Decor:

If the spoon is mostly for serving or looks, you can choose a softer wood or a more colorful one, like walnut. These spoons do not need extreme durability but should feel good to hold. Lighter woods, like birch, are great for salad servers.

Carving Experience:

Beginners should start with medium-soft woods like basswood (though less common for eating spoons) or fresh green birch. These woods allow you to learn tool control without fighting the grain too much.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Spoon Wood

Q: Should I use green wood or dried wood?

A: Green wood (freshly cut) is much easier to carve. Dried wood is harder but the spoon will not shrink or warp after you finish it.

Q: Can I use pine or fir for spoons?

A: It is best not to use pine or fir. These are softwoods. They have a very open grain and usually contain strong resin, which can impart unwanted flavors.

Q: What is the best wood for a spoon that won’t stain?

A: Maple is excellent at resisting stains. Its hard, tight grain does not let pigments soak in easily.

Q: Do I need to oil my wooden spoon after carving?

A: Yes, always oil your finished spoon. Use food-safe mineral oil or walnut oil. Oiling protects the wood from moisture and prevents cracking.

Q: How do I know if a wood is food-safe?

A: Stick to common fruitwoods, maples, and walnuts. Avoid exotic woods unless you are certain they are non-toxic. Never use wood from trees that might have been sprayed with pesticides.

Q: Will my wooden spoon absorb the smell of garlic?

A: Denser woods like maple absorb less odor than softer woods. Regular oiling also helps seal the surface against smells.

Q: What makes a spoon crack after I finish it?

A: Cracking usually happens when the wood dries too quickly or unevenly. This is common if you carve dry wood or if you wash a new spoon in hot water immediately.

Q: Is exotic wood like teak safe for spoons?

A: Teak is durable, but some people have skin sensitivities to it. If you use exotic woods, research toxicity thoroughly first.

Q: Does the age of the tree matter for spoon quality?

A: The age matters less than the health of the wood. You want wood from a healthy tree, free of internal decay.

Q: Are laminated spoons better than solid spoons?

A: Laminated spoons (made from glued pieces) can be very strong, but they have glue lines. For traditional carving, solid wood is preferred for its clean look and traditional feel.
